If you are suffering from tinnitus, try to keep your life as stress-free as possible. Your condition

can make the normal day-to-day stresses of life seem even more difficult to handle. The higher

your stress level, the harder it becomes to cope with even minor discomforts. Tinnitus will be

easier to deal with if you aren't fretting over other stressful problems.
